Marie J
Esquilin
July 29, 1930 – December 13, 2021
Marie J. Esquilin was born July 29, 1930, in Tallahassee, FL to the late Oscar and Virginia Brown. With boundless joy and great surprise, 30 minutes later her twin brother Morris Nhere was born. She departed this life on Monday, December 13, 2021.
Marie enjoyed her early childhood education in Florida. The family later moved to New Jersey where her Grandmother Mickens, lived next-door to the Union Baptist Temple Church. After Grandmother Mickens passing, the home was sold to Union Baptist Temple, the church she loved so much.
Marie graduated from Bridgeton High School and went to work for Owens Illinois Glass Company. Marie Brown and Ralph Esquilin, were married over sixty years. They enjoyed each other while having fun and traveling to Puerto Rico. Ralph gave his life to God and began attending church with his wife. These were the best times of her life.
Marie elected to retire early and become a housewife. Marie was loved by her family and many friends. She took on the task of babysitting her niece Margie's son Jason, while Margie attended college. Marie fell in love with Jason and until this day, Jason calls Marie and Ralph, Mom and Dad.
Marie was a very quiet but strong person, a lover of God, a lover of family and exotic food. She was an avid skater and enjoyed skating at Franklinville Skating Rink. She was a member of Crusaders for Christ Church, Bridgeton, NJ. She was one of the early members and she faithfully attended, until suffering a light stroke. She was then moved to Genesis Rehabilitation Center, where her devoted husband, Ralph Esquilin, would visit daily, bringing her food and clean clothing. Ralph's dedication to his beloved wife continued until he became disabled.
Marie was predeceased by her parents Oscar and Virginia Brown, sisters Lillie and Estine, brothers Frank and Lenton Brown, nephew Daryl Nelson and brother-in-law James Goldsboro.
She leaves to cherish her memory and to carry on God's love, her beloved husband Ralph, son Ralph Jr. (Towanda), sister Hazel Goldsboro, brother Morris Brown (Betty); grandchildren Ditaniel, Alexander and Eric; Great grandchildren Ditaniel Jr., Alana, Sheylan, Makaylyn, Dallas, and Brooklyn; Nephews: Lenton Jr, Carey, Clinton, Terry, Michael, and Alfredo; Nieces: Tina, Marjorie, Valerie, Britt, Denise, Ollievita, Poulani.
